High blood cholesterol problem may result in critical complications such as cardiac problems. You may have high blood cholesterol due to several reasons. You can control some of these factors, but some of them can’t be controlled. Your lifestyle is one of the most significant factors leading to high blood cholesterol. But sometimes it is seen that people going through a perfectly healthy lifestyle may suffer from high blood cholesterol. This may be a hereditary factor that is one of the major factors influencing cholesterol in our blood stream.
Normally, our body produces a certain amount of cholesterol. The individuals, who are predisposed with the risk for high blood cholesterol problem, can only depend on medications prescribed by health expert. They need to maintain a healthy lifestyle and have a full balanced diet comprising of healthy foods that lower cholesterol. They need to work on some important factors such as weight management and diet.

Avoid sitting in front of the computer for a long period of time. If your daily routine lacks physical activities, you are running a high risk of having several complications such as high cholesterol. Even doing some simple exercises such as walking for an hour daily can help you manage your cholesterol level. If you can include exercise in your daily schedule, you are on the way to manage blood pressure level.
If you have high blood cholesterol, you need to check your body weight regularly. If you find yourself overweight, you should take the appropriate measure immediately to lose your weight.

Soluble fiber helps in managing high cholesterol by absorbing it and then extracting it out of the body through the digestive system. Foods that are good source of soluble fiber are Apples, blackberries, oranges, apricots, peas, beans, broccoli, grapefruit, and sweet potato.
Omega 3 fatty acids are up to a significant level. You should take mackerel, salmon, sardines, and many others in your daily diet to fulfill the demand for omega 3 fatty acids in your system. Omega 3 fatty acids help in minimizing cardiovascular problems. If you do not want to take so much fatty fishes, you can always depend on substitute foods that lower cholesterol such as walnuts, soybeans, and ground flax.
